Solution for 0.13(-4x+2)=0.05x+6 equation:


Simplifying
0.13(-4x + 2) = 0.05x + 6

Reorder the terms:
0.13(2 + -4x) = 0.05x + 6
(2 * 0.13 + -4x * 0.13) = 0.05x + 6
(0.26 + -0.52x) = 0.05x + 6

Reorder the terms:
0.26 + -0.52x = 6 + 0.05x

Solving
0.26 + -0.52x = 6 + 0.05x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-0.05x' to each side of the equation.
0.26 + -0.52x + -0.05x = 6 + 0.05x + -0.05x

Combine like terms: -0.52x + -0.05x = -0.57x
0.26 + -0.57x = 6 + 0.05x + -0.05x

Combine like terms: 0.05x + -0.05x = 0.00
0.26 + -0.57x = 6 + 0.00
0.26 + -0.57x = 6

Add '-0.26' to each side of the equation.
0.26 + -0.26 + -0.57x = 6 + -0.26

Combine like terms: 0.26 + -0.26 = 0.00
0.00 + -0.57x = 6 + -0.26
-0.57x = 6 + -0.26

Combine like terms: 6 + -0.26 = 5.74
-0.57x = 5.74

Divide each side by '-0.57'.
x = -10.07017544

Simplifying
x = -10.07017544
